Pyramid - Pyramid 1975


The mystery band of the Pyramid label,
 the eponymous 1 track album would seem to be what
Toby Robinson told me was their attempt at a Cosmic Jokers type album.

"Dawn Defender" is quite obviously mixed from many different sessions,
 and runs a wide range of styles, from trippy Ash Ra Tempel with echo guitars

 and scintillating synthesizers through to headfirst plunges into Hawkwind overdrive territory.
 The feel is much like what Porcupine Tree and Electric Orange have attempted more recently,
 that is except for the authentic Mellotron textures and old analogue delay techniques.
 In all, an excellent album of spacey Krautrock.

By Alan Freeman
